How do I monitor WAP?


Pramati Server, apart from providing you with all the features of a robust Server, comes combined with the power to check the activities of Wireless Application Protocol (WAP) enabled applications on the Server. A list of URLs is provided on the Console to keep track of the WAP applications deployed using the Server.

This section describes how to monitor the WAP services provided by Pramati Server.

Select Utilities > WAP on the Console. You can access information about Server configuration, applications deployed on Pramati Server, and alerts configured through WAP enabled devices.

The following information is displayed:

Table 1: Monitoring WAP details

InformationURL
Pramati Server ConfigurationURL address where the Pramati Server Configuration is stored.
Applications DeployedURL address where the deployed applications are stored.
AlertsURL address where the alerts are stored.

Clicking any of the links provided for information displays the respective screen.

How do I monitor Pramati Server configuration?

Clicking Pramati Server Configuration displays the following details:

Table 2: Pramati Server Configuration Details

FieldDescription
HostDisplays the Host IP address, say 192.168.1.143.
Lookup PortDisplays the lookup port, say 9191.
HTTP PortDisplays the HTTP port, say 80.
Start TimeDisplays the day, date, and the time when the Pramati Server had started.
